The short version
Shively is home to 15,157 people in Kentucky. 8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ree, below the 24% national rate. At a median age of 40.5, this is an older place than the country as a whole. Home values have risen by half since 1990, reaching $83,900. Median rent is $425 a month. Households take in $31,422 at the median, 26% less than the US figure.
